Halle Berry ‘Would Love’ To Direct ‘Catwoman’ Remake

Catwoman actress Halle Berry recently revealed that she would be interested in revisiting the character as a director.

Many actresses have taken a crack at Catwoman, with Zoe Kravitz becoming the latest to take on the role in next year’s The Batman. Over the years, there have also been rumors of many Catwoman solo projects with Kravitz, Anne Hathaway, and Michelle Pfeiffer. However, Halle Berry was the only one to play the character without a Batman.

Halle Berry’s Catwoman film is widely considered to be one of the worst comic book movies ever, but that isn’t stopping the Oscar-winning actress turned Bruised director from wanting to revisit the character. While speaking with Jake’s Takes, Berry said the following about a return to Catwoman:

“I would love to direct Catwoman. If I can get ahold of that now, knowing what I know, having had this experience [on ‘Bruised’], and reimagine that world the way I reimagined this story. ‘Bruised’ was written for a white Irish Catholic 25-year-old girl, and I got to reimagine it. I wish I could go back and reimagine Catwoman and redo that. Have a redo on that, now knowing what I know [about directing]. I would have Catwoman saving the world like most male superheroes do, and not just saving women from their faces cracking off. I would make the stakes a lot higher, and I think make it more inclusive of both men and women.”

Here’s the synopsis for the upcoming Batman film starring Zoe Kravitz as Catwoman:

“THE BATMAN is an edgy, action-packed thriller that depicts Batman in his early years, struggling to balance rage with righteousness as he investigates a disturbing mystery that has terrorized Gotham. Robert Pattinson delivers a raw, intense portrayal of Batman as a disillusioned, desperate vigilante awakened by the realization that the anger consuming him makes him no better than the ruthless serial killer he’s hunting.”

Directed by Matt Reeves, The Batman stars Robert Pattinson as the titular hero, Zoe Kravitz as Catwoman, Paul Dano as the Riddler, Jeffrey Wright as James Gordon, John Turturro as Carmine Falcone, Peter Sarsgaard as Gil Colson, Jayme Lawson as Bella Reál, with Andy Serkis as Alfred Pennyworth, and Colin Farrell as the Penguin.
